Arung Population - Papumpare, Arunachal Pradesh
Arung is a small village located in Mengio Circle of Papumpare district, Arunachal Pradesh with total 32 families residing. The Arung village has population of 175 of which 84 are males while 91 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Arung village population of children with age 0-6 is 17 which makes up 9.71 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Arung village is 1083 which is higher than Arunachal Pradesh state average of 938. Child Sex Ratio for the Arung as per census is 1429, higher than Arunachal Pradesh average of 972.
Arung village has higher literacy rate compared to Arunachal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Arung village was 69.62 % compared to 65.38 % of Arunachal Pradesh. In Arung Male literacy stands at 77.92 % while female literacy rate was 61.73 %.
